## Environments — Quillpost Digest Service

Quillpost batches customer emails into daily digests. Staging runs digests hourly for testing; production runs them once per recipient timezone at 07:00 local. Support should never trigger manual sends in production without a ticket. When diagnosing a missed digest, first confirm which environment the account lives in, then compare against the scheduler configuration shown below.

deployment values, yadug-bawif:
[framir]
team = pelox
access_code = ac_a38ab2
owner = tamion.julael
host = framir.tolvaqlabs.test
port = 11211
peer = tammir.zemvargrid.local
salt = 2215ef03
pin = 1541

TURN-208: Gatevale turnstile counters at the Merrow Field pilot double-count when a rotation reverses mid-cycle. Attendance totals drift roughly 2% high per event. The debounce window fix is implemented, reviewed by Ilsa, and soak-tested across two simulated match days without drift. Ready for your cut; the candidate build is identified below.

trace token, tagag-tafog: htk6_5ed18c

## Service Accounts — Pooler

Quick note for the sync: the Tidegate connection pooler uses a dedicated service account, not app credentials, so pool limits are enforced per-service. If your service is getting throttled, it's probably hitting the shared account instead. To connect through the pooler directly, authenticate with the internal key below.

app token of yajeg-kawef = kto11_7En3XSX8xQw

Step 4: Run the string extraction pass for Lintwhistle before building. The extract-i18n script walks every template in the Quartavia frontend and regenerates the catalog files under locales/. If the diff touches more than 200 keys, ping the translation channel before proceeding. Once the catalog is committed, the release bundle must be signed so the CDN accepts it. Sign with the key below.

deploy key for kajof-fajop: bky6_gDHw9Q

Step 4: Ship the renderer. Once the Quillfax PDF invoice renderer passes the smoke render (open sample-invoice-layouts and eyeball the totals column — it loves to drop trailing zeros), push the build to the staging bucket and tag it with the sprint name. Support folks: if a customer reports blank pages after this, it's almost always a stale font cache, not the deploy. Before promoting to prod, verify the artifact is signed with the key below.

release key, fahaf-bajof: bky3_Xam